Gmail accommodates both of these things. Again, you can set up filters
that keep all kinds of things out of your inbox by choosing "Skip the
inbox" when creating the filter. The only stuff that hits my inbox are
things I actually want there (aside from the things I didn't
anticipate, but that's true for *any* email client).
